Commercial Slab Construction in Charleston, SC
Commercial slab construction services involve the installation of concrete foundations and flooring for a variety of business and industrial projects. These projects can include the creation of warehouse floors, retail store fo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and other large-scale flat surfaces essential for property operations.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the work, the durability of the slab, and how it will support their specific business needs, ensuring that the foundation is stable and long-lasting for years to come.
Before requesting commercial slab construction, property owners should consider factors such as the size and layout of the project, the type of load it will need to support, and any site-specific conditions like soil type and drainage requirements. Clarifying these details helps ensure the project is designed and executed to meet the functional demands of the property, providing a solid base for ongoing operations and minimizing potential issues related to settling or cracking over time.

Common Commercial Slab Construction Jobs
Commercial slab foundations - provide a stable base for retail stores, warehouses, and office buildings.
Parking lot slabs - create durable surfaces for parking areas and vehicle access points.
Loading dock slabs - support heavy equipment and frequent vehicle loading operations.
Sidewalk and walkway slabs - enhance pedestrian safety and accessibility around commercial properties.
Storage and utility slabs - serve as bases for equipment, HVAC units, and storage areas.
Industrial floor slabs - withstand heavy machinery and high traffic in manufacturing facilities.
Commercial Slab Construction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king areas,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ties.
What materials are used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the primary material, often reinforced with steel to ensure durability and strength for heavy use.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ness varies depending on the project, but typically ranges from 4 to 8 inches to support the intended load.
What factors influence the cost of a commercial slab? Factors include size, thickness, site preparation needs, and the type of reinforcement used in the concrete.
